Concrete Smoothing Service in Louisville, KY
Concrete smoothing services involve refining and leveling existing concrete surfaces to achieve a clean, even finish. This process is commonly used for driveways, patios, walkways, garage floors, and other outdoor or indoor surfaces where a smooth, professional appearance is desired. Property owners typically request this service to improve the aesthetic appeal of their concrete installations, reduce surface irregularities, and create a safe, slip-resistant surface suitable for everyday use. Before requesting concrete smoothing, it’s helpful to understand the current condition of the concrete, including any cracks, uneven areas, or surface damage, as these factors can influence the scope of work needed.
Homeowners and property owners should consider the type of finish they want, whether a matte, polished, or textured surface, and discuss any specific durability or safety requirements. It’s also important to evaluate the age and condition of the existing concrete, as older or heavily damaged surfaces may require additional preparation or repairs before smoothing. Proper surface preparation ensures a long-lasting, high-quality result, making it beneficial to seek guidance on suitable finishes and maintenance practices to preserve the smooth surface over time.

Common Concrete Smoothing Service Jobs
Driveway smoothing - creates a level surface for safer vehicle access and improved curb appeal.
Garage floor finishing - provides a smooth, durable surface for parking and storage areas.
Patio and walkway prep - prepares existing concrete for a polished, even finish for outdoor spaces.
Concrete slab leveling - corrects uneven surfaces to prevent tripping hazards and structural issues.
Pool deck resurfacing - enhances the appearance and safety of outdoor pool areas with a smooth finish.
Commercial floor finishing - ensures large concrete surfaces are even and safe for daily use.
Concrete Smoothing Service Questions
What surfaces can be smoothed with this service? Concrete smoothing can be applied to driveways, patios, walkways, and other flat concrete surfaces to improve appearance and functionality.
Is concrete smoothing suitable for old or damaged concrete? Yes, it can help improve the surface by creating a more even and refined finish, even on older or slightly damaged concrete.
What are common reasons to choose concrete smoothing? It is often requested to enhance surface appearance, eliminate unevenness, and prepare concrete for additional finishes or coatings.
How does concrete smoothing impact the durability of a surface? Smoothing can help create a uniform surface that resists cracking and reduces surface imperfections, contributing to longer-lasting concrete.
